    Long description:

    First Published in 1993. Using four in-depth case studies, this book greatly adds to our understanding of what are often called subgovernments. A work of solid social science with a welcome feel of reality, this is essential reading for anyone interested in public policy-making.

    More

    Table of Contents:

    Chapter 1 Introduction; Chapter 2 The Bureau of Reclamation; Chapter 3 The Bureau of Indian Affairs; Chapter 4 The Food and Drug Administration; Chapter 5 The Social and Rehabilitation Service; Chapter 6 Conclusions;
